Former Manchester United and Everton winger Andrei Kanchelskis says the Premier League race is too close to call.
Liverpool are currently four points clear of Manchester City at the top of the table.
Kanchelskis told Sport-Express, "Everything will be decided in January and February - the most intense months.
"We'll see how Liverpool and Manchester City last the distance. It will be decided by the depth of the bench.
"At the end of February, I think I can answer your question."
He added, "United? The main thing - to get into the top four, in the Champions League. They won't get the title."
